MY ATTEMPT AT A STORYLINE: This game takes place in a totally different universe than that of ours. The solar system humans live in: Center- The Sun (Star name: "Empisto-sunai"; after the greek word for trust; called "Empisto" for short) Planets - rotate around it in totally different paths (Like electrons/protons in an atom around the nucleus) The race of your character (Kusitè; pronounced "coo-see-tay"; comes from greek word for confuse) is one that looks similar to humans. They have arms, legs, 10 fingers and toes, etc. This race, however, is "powered" by "eating" a little slug-like animal (Singular - Krott; Plural - Kroth)that grows on their planet, burrowing about 15 feet into the ground in little colonies (shaped similar to ant colonies, but bigger). Its breeding season never ends, and it multiplies fast. It has a special chemical (Thavios) in its blood that gives it energy. It is also known as common knowledge that the only other source of the same kind of energy is in Kusite blood (which carries the same chemical roughly 50 times more abundantly; the Kusitè don''t need much anyways, so if need be, a group of 10 of them could last on one body for 5 days or so) The Kusitè planet, Aphthonos, has much in the way of resources. There are literally mountains made of different metals. Pockets of oil everywhere. etc, etc. Their race is in an industrial age. They actually used to be VERY technologically advanced. There was a huge disease that spread, doing as much damage as the black plague, only throughout the whole planet (long ago), known only as The Cancer. As a result, very few lived who know the technological secrets that the whole race once knew. The human planet (remember, this is a dif universe) is called Ghae (Pronouced "Hi") and is quickly running out of resources. The oceans and atmosphere are terribly polluted from past ages, though most everything is solar powered now. Metals are becoming rare, though new ways of creating artificial metals, etc are being found. They have immense technology. When astronauts found life on Aphthonos, the government got interested fast (the planets are very, very far apart), though it was kept secret within the government. When they found out that it had the metals they needed, they would almost do anything to get control. The humans easily found about the Kroth and their connection to Kusitè. They sent covert teams to harvest these slimy creatures, needing only soil rich in minerals to soak into their bodies in order to live. After having done some experiments, they created a toxin to them, (actually a tiny, tiny insect that crawled inside a Krott body and ate its organs)and released it onto the planet Aphthonos. Their mission was a success, now they only had to wait for the race of Kusitè to die off so they could harvest their precious resources. Very few of the Kusitè knew exactly what''s going on (with the humans). There was a small group of them who survived the age of The Cancer by escaping into a ship. Their offspring live now, in that same ship, once nameless, now known as the Star Ship Absolution, built with immense stealth capability. They are in constant watch over their own race, so to speak, also keeping tabs on humans. The incredible technology they possessed included almost infinite surveillance capability. They knew about the mission to kill off all life on Aphthonos, and could do nothing to stop it. So they did all they could do. They set out to destroy all who knew about Aphthonos and the operation there. They finished their mission--or so they thought. One scientist evaded their reach. They found out about Dr. Neil Rencher years after their mission was over by looking through salvaged records of the operation on Aphthonos. To this day they haven''t found Rencher... ------------------------------ Now, I''m thinking of making it so you start out as a normal Kusite citizen in a ruined Aphthonos city, with chaos around. Well, nice story, but it''s not really a game design. From a design perspective it could all be paraphrased as "you have a spaceship and you need to find some guys".
